Austin Spurs Fall Short to Salt Lake City Stars

December 27, 2019 - NBA G League (G League)
Austin Spurs News Release


SALT LAKE CITY - The Austin Spurs (9-9), presented by SWBC, fell to the Salt Lake City Stars (14-2) by a final score of 127-102 on the road Friday night.

San Antonio Spurs assignee Chimezie Metu recorded 18 points and 9 rebounds in 29 minutes. Spurs assignee Keldon Johnson posted 15 points, 6 rebounds and 2 blocks in 29 minutes. Dedric Lawson tallied 13 points and 6 rebounds in 28 minutes, while Galen Robinson Jr. contributed 12 points and 4 assists in 23 minutes.

For Salt Lake City, Jarrell Brantley put up 24 points, 8 rebounds and 5 assists in 27 minutes. Justin Wright-Foreman added 21 points, 4 rebounds and 5 assists in 29 minutes in the team's win.
